
A man arrested by the Rajouri Garden police in an alleged theft case managed to escape from custody by breaking the iron bars of the lockup, an officer said.
Later, Deepak RDX was recaptured in the same area, authorities confirmed on Friday.
RDX had been apprehended last week in connection with a theft case and was held in a temporary lockup at the Special Staff Office near Rajouri Garden Police Station.
Upon discovering his absence, the staff promptly notified their superiors, an officer mentioned. Deepak was apprehended by the team from the same area the following day.
Police stated that a case under section 224 (resistance or obstruction by a person to his lawful apprehension) of the IPC has been filed against him at Rajouri Garden Police Station. (With inputs from PTI)
